Chemical Reactions & Equations

Q. 1. In a chemical reaction between sulphuric acid and barium chloride solution the white precipitates formed are of:

(A) Hydrochloric acid
(B) Barium sulphate
(C) Chlorine
(D) Sulphur

Right Ans:- Barium sulphate


Q. 2. The respiration process during which glucose undergoes slow combustion by combining with oxygen in the cells of our body to produce energy, is a kind of:

(A) Exothermic process
(B) Endothermic process
(C) Reversible process
(D) Physical process

Right Ans:- Exothermic process


Q. 3. One of the following processes does not involve a chemical reaction. That is:

(A) Melting of candle wax when heated
(B) Burning of candle wax when heated
(C) Digestion of food in our stomach
(D) Ripening of banana

Right Ans:- Melting of candle wax when heated


Q. 4. It is necessary to balance a chemical equation in order to satisfy the law of:

(A) Conservation of motion
(B) Conservation of momentum
(C) Conservation of energy
(D) Conservation of mass

Right Ans:- Conservation of mass


Q. 5. Rusting of iron involves a chemical reaction which is a combination of:

(A) Reduction as well as combination reactions
(B) Oxidation as well as combination reactions
(C) Reduction as well as displacement reactions
(D) Oxidation as well as displacement reactions

Right Ans:- Oxidation as well as combination reactions


Q. 6. When ferrous sulphate is heated strongly it undergoes decomposition to form ferric oxide as a main product accompanied by a change in colour from:

(A) Blue to green.
(B) Green to blue.
(C) Green to brown.
(D) Green to yellow.

Right Ans:- Green to brown


Q. 7. Which of the following gases is used in the storage of fat and oil containing foods for a long time?

(A) Carbondioxide gas
(B) Nitrogen gas
(C) Oxygen gas
(D) Neon gas  

Right Ans:- Nitrogen gas


Q. 8. The displacement reaction between iron (III) oxide and a metal X is used for welding the rail tracks. Here X is:

(A) Copper granules
(B) Magnesium ribbon
(C) Sodium pellets
(D) Aluminium dust

Right Ans:- Aluminium dust


Q. 9. The neutralization reaction between an acid and a base is a type of:

(A) Double displacement reaction
(B) Displacement reaction
(C) Addition reaction
(D) Decomposition reaction

Right Ans:- Double displacement reaction
